- [ ] Step 7: Archive cold storage buckets (Glacierline tier). Confirm both ceremony witnesses are present, verify bucket manifests match the Oxbow ledger, then seal the archive key shares. Plugin authors may observe but not handle shares. Once sealed, the archive index itself is encrypted and can only be reopened with the passphrase below.

vault phrase of badup-hahig = tamael-aldael-kelmir-istael-fenok-istwyn-tamius-jorath-oliion

## Perchlist API — Environments

The Perchlist public REST API paginates all list endpoints with cursor tokens. Three environments exist: dev, staging, prod. Page-size limits differ per environment; staging mirrors prod, dev is looser for testing. Never hardcode page sizes — clients must follow the cursor until it's null. Each environment applies the pagination settings listed below.

deployment values, kajep-kageg:
[praix]
host = praix.paliqcorp.corp
user = praix_svc
database = praix_prod

Runbook: tailwhistle — internal log tailing CLI

Quick context for review: tailwhistle streams logs from the Copperbay aggregator with server-side filtering, so heavy regexes run remotely, not on your laptop. Flags are stable; don't rename them without a deprecation cycle. Sessions auto-expire after an hour of silence. The CLI picks up its defaults from the values shown below.

settings of yagag-kahop:
FENWYN_PIN=6385
FENWYN_METRICS_HOST=metrics.fenwyn.nelvrolabs.corp
FENWYN_LOG_LEVEL=error
FENWYN_TENANT=casok